Product

Kantha is a technique of layering well-worn cloth and creating a pattern using just one stitch at a time. The textile recycling needlework that was passed down to women in India is starting to attract attention in Japan. This is an introductory guide to Kantha that provides detailed explanations from preparing the cloth to how to stitch various patterns.

■About the author
Host of "Mari Mochizuki and Friends".
Born as the eldest daughter of handicraft artist Mari Mochizuki (1926-2023).
I lived in the UK for 6 years and earned a diploma in garden design from the London School of Art. After returning to Japan, he worked as a garden designer. At the same time, we support Mari Mochizuki's Kanta creations and classroom activities.
Currently, while following Mari Mochizuki's kantha, she creates kantha that fits modern life with free colors and designs, and holds classes and workshops.
Supervised the book “Kantha Embroidery: Its Motifs and Techniques” written by Mari Mochizuki (published by Seibundo Shinkosha in 2021).
